.brochure_brochurePage__z5OUy{font-family:Montserrat,sans-serif;background:linear-gradient(135deg,#BCE1FF,#1D61C3);width:1440px;height:1692px;margin:0 auto;padding:2.5rem 3rem;box-sizing:border-box;color:var(--text-main);overflow:hidden;display:flex;flex-direction:column}@media (max-width:768px){.brochure_brochurePage__z5OUy{width:100%;height:auto;overflow:visible;padding:1.25rem 1rem}}.brochure_header__NRivQ{justify-content:space-between;margin-bottom:2rem;flex-wrap:wrap}.brochure_header__NRivQ,.brochure_logoArea__lXGZz{display:flex;align-items:center;gap:1rem}.brochure_logo__msfV7{display:block}.brochure_verticalLine__jx0NK{width:1.5px;height:52px;background-color:var(--accent);flex-shrink:0}.brochure_tagline__fE_Xu{font-family:Montserrat,sans-serif;font-weight:300;font-size:20px;line-height:1;letter-spacing:0;color:var(--blue-dark);margin:0}.brochure_contactRow__BXfvD{display:flex;align-items:center;gap:1rem}.brochure_phone__3tCBk{font-family:Montserrat,sans-serif;font-weight:700;font-size:15px;line-height:1;letter-spacing:0;color:var(--blue-dark);margin:0;white-space:nowrap}.brochure_socialNav__P_rOC{display:flex;align-items:center;gap:.5rem}.brochure_socialLink__lZZOf{display:flex;flex-direction:column;align-items:center;gap:3px;text-decoration:none}.brochure_socialIcon__w80Xs{width:36px;height:36px;object-fit:contain}.brochure_socialHandle__nX8kW{font-family:Montserrat,sans-serif;font-weight:700;font-size:10px;line-height:1;letter-spacing:0;text-align:center;color:var(--blue-dark)}.brochure_horizontalLine__yeD4X{border:none;height:1.5px;background-color:var(--accent);margin:0 0 2rem}@media (max-width:768px){.brochure_phone__3tCBk,.brochure_tagline__fE_Xu,.brochure_verticalLine__jx0NK{display:none}}.brochure_mainGrid__1D2zQ{display:grid;grid-template-columns:1fr 1fr;grid-gap:1.5rem;gap:1.5rem;margin-bottom:1rem;flex:1 1;min-height:0}.brochure_brochureCol__gJTkk{display:flex;flex-direction:column;gap:1.5rem;height:100%}.brochure_brochureCol__gJTkk>:last-child{flex:1 1}@media (max-width:768px){.brochure_mainGrid__1D2zQ{grid-template-columns:1fr}}.brochure_cardSection__9tTbs{background:linear-gradient(180deg,rgba(234,239,255,.9),rgba(201,218,247,.88));border-radius:var(--radius-card);padding:1.25rem 1.25rem 1.5rem}.brochure_sectionTitle__GiyCh{font-size:32px;color:var(--blue-dark);margin:0 0 1rem}.brochure_sectionTitleBlue__p6gRG,.brochure_sectionTitle__GiyCh{font-family:Montserrat,sans-serif;font-weight:700;line-height:1;letter-spacing:0}.brochure_sectionTitleBlue__p6gRG{font-size:25px;color:var(--text-main);background-color:var(--blue-light);border-radius:var(--radius-sub);padding:.4rem 1rem;margin:0 0 .75rem;display:block}.brochure_expertise__Is_8R{margin-bottom:0}.brochure_expertiseGrid__Yara6{display:grid;grid-template-columns:repeat(6,1fr);grid-gap:.75rem;gap:.75rem;text-align:center}@media (max-width:768px){.brochure_expertiseGrid__Yara6{grid-template-columns:repeat(3,1fr)}}@media (max-width:480px){.brochure_expertiseGrid__Yara6{grid-template-columns:repeat(3,1fr)}}.brochure_expertiseItem__a5rqr{display:flex;flex-direction:column;align-items:center;gap:6px}.brochure_expertiseIcon__8Xk4b{width:48px;height:48px;object-fit:contain}.brochure_expertiseLabel__JEbjp{font-family:Montserrat,sans-serif;font-weight:700;font-size:10px;line-height:1;letter-spacing:0;color:var(--blue-dark);text-align:center}.brochure_tech__BQufG{margin-bottom:0}.brochure_techList__0zeHz{list-style:none;padding:0;margin:0 0 .5rem}.brochure_techItem___DUOw{font-family:Montserrat,sans-serif;font-size:17px;line-height:1;letter-spacing:0;color:var(--text-main);padding:6px 0;display:flex;align-items:flex-start;gap:8px}.brochure_techItem___DUOw:before{content:"•";color:var(--blue-mid);font-size:14px;flex-shrink:0;margin-top:1px}.brochure_techItemName__uiMjk{font-weight:600}.brochure_techItemDesc__a7Kmd{font-weight:400}.brochure_industries__5Fu0k{margin-bottom:0}.brochure_industriesGrid__Rzbst{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:1rem;gap:1rem;text-align:center}@media (max-width:768px){.brochure_industriesGrid__Rzbst{grid-template-columns:repeat(2,1fr)}}.brochure_industryItem__KHkkJ{display:flex;flex-direction:column;align-items:center;gap:6px}.brochure_industryIcon__kOLHr{width:48px;height:48px;object-fit:contain}.brochure_industryLabel__0mh_I{font-family:Montserrat,sans-serif;font-weight:700;font-size:10px;line-height:1.2;letter-spacing:0;color:var(--blue-dark);text-align:center}.brochure_certifications__sGu2w{margin-bottom:0}.brochure_certsGrid__zGiAg{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:1.5rem 1rem;gap:1.5rem 1rem;text-align:center}@media (max-width:480px){.brochure_certsGrid__zGiAg{grid-template-columns:1fr 1fr;gap:1rem}}.brochure_certItem__BmcJ9{display:flex;flex-direction:column;align-items:center;gap:10px}.brochure_certIcon__dI3qW{width:110px;height:110px;object-fit:contain}.brochure_certLabel__CtLKa{font-family:Montserrat,sans-serif;font-weight:500;font-size:20px;line-height:1;letter-spacing:0;text-align:center;color:var(--blue-dark)}.brochure_certSingle__rD4vr{grid-column:1/-1;display:flex;justify-content:center}.brochure_teamCard__xhrPG{background:linear-gradient(180deg,rgba(234,239,255,.9),rgba(201,218,247,.88));border-radius:var(--radius-card);padding:1.5rem 1.5rem 1.5rem 1.75rem;display:flex;align-items:center;gap:1.5rem;flex-wrap:nowrap}.brochure_teamPhoto__SDW7B{width:180px;height:178px;object-fit:cover;border-radius:12px;flex-shrink:0}.brochure_teamInfo__mqbHm{flex:1 1;min-width:200px}.brochure_teamName__Yfz_B{font-weight:700;font-size:48px;margin:0 0 .5rem;white-space:nowrap}.brochure_teamName__Yfz_B,.brochure_teamRole__8jexp{font-family:Montserrat,sans-serif;line-height:1;letter-spacing:0;color:var(--blue-dark)}.brochure_teamRole__8jexp{font-weight:400;font-size:32px;margin:0}.brochure_teamQr__hD3Nr{width:100px;height:100px;object-fit:contain;flex-shrink:0}@media (max-width:768px){.brochure_teamName__Yfz_B{font-size:38px}.brochure_teamRole__8jexp{font-size:20px}.brochure_teamPhoto__SDW7B{width:120px;height:118px}.brochure_teamQr__hD3Nr{display:none}}@media (max-width:480px){.brochure_teamCard__xhrPG{padding:1rem;gap:1rem}.brochure_teamName__Yfz_B{font-size:28px}.brochure_teamRole__8jexp{font-size:16px}.brochure_teamPhoto__SDW7B{width:90px;height:88px}}.brochure_downloadRow__cU7F1{display:flex;justify-content:flex-end;padding-top:.75rem;flex-shrink:0}.brochure_downloadBtn__bBJQJ{font-family:Montserrat,sans-serif;font-weight:800;font-size:25px;color:#0B9DDA;background:transparent;border:2px solid #0b9dda;border-radius:15px;padding:0 .8rem;display:inline-block;text-decoration:none;cursor:pointer;transition:color .2s ease,box-shadow .2s ease;white-space:nowrap}.brochure_downloadBtn__bBJQJ:hover{color:#06244F;box-shadow:0 0 0 2px #0B9DDA}@media (max-width:991px){.brochure_downloadBtn__bBJQJ{width:100%;text-align:center}}.brochure_divider__T0CdB{border:none;height:1.5px;background-color:var(--accent);margin:1rem 0}